July 31 Special Holiday in Marinduque
Law
Republic Act No. 9749
Decision Date
Nov 10, 2009
Republic Act No. 9749 declares July 31 as a special nonworking holiday in Marinduque to honor the heroes and heroines of the Battle of Paye, encouraging participation from various sectors of society in commemorative programs and activities.
A

Responsibilities for Commemorative Activities

  • The provincial government of Marinduque and the Municipal Government of Boac are tasked to lead the commemorative programs.
  • Coordination with the National Historical Institute is required to ensure appropriateness and meaningfulness of the activities.
  • Officials and employees from national, provincial, and municipal government agencies and instrumentalities must participate.
  • Civic, religious, nongovernment, business, and civil society organizations are encouraged to take part.
  • The activities aim to honor the heroes and heroines of the Battle of Paye.

Effectivity of the Act

  • The Act takes effect immediately upon approval.
  • The law was approved on November 10, 2009, following its passage by the House of Representatives and the Senate on November 17, 2008, and August 24, 2009, respectively.
